If your a large ship, (stormcarrier) take your AE out and put him in a shuttle. Tractor your CC and drag it to wherever you want! This is way faster than using the hyperdrive on your CC. Guest MIKE113 Posted August 14, 2002 Report Posted August 14, 2002 I use my shuttles to tow me around all the time! The only odd thing that happens is occasionally you will end up in Null Space region. Much faster if you rotate shuttles in & out,(low recharge time).
